Test Enables Early Diagnosis of Chlamydia

A highly sensitive, qualitative 90-minute test has been developed for detection of Chlamydia trachomatis (C trachomatis), even in the early stages of infection. More...


Chlamydia is one of the most common sexually transmitted diseases (STDs). In addition to urogenital disease, C trachomatis causes trachoma, a chronic, recurrent infection of the conjunctiva and cornea, especially widespread in the tropics. According to the World Health Organization (WHO, Geneva, Switzerland), 500 million people worldwide are in danger of infection, over 140 million are already infected, and more than six million have been blinded due to chlamydia infection, mostly in developing countries.

The C trachomatis bacterium contains five to 10 copies of a conserved 7.5 kb cryptic plasmid. Using this plasmid as a target enables highly sensitive detection of C trachomatis. However, since plasmid-free C trachomatis bacteria have also been previously detected, conventional tests for C trachomatis that are based solely on detection of the chlamydial cryptic plasmid are not always reliable.

The CE-marked Artus C trachomatis plus polymerase chain reaction (PCR) kit produced by Qiagen (Hamburg, Germany) detects a region of the ompA gene, which encodes the major outer membrane protein (MOMP), in addition to sequences on the cryptic plasmid.

This highly sensitive, qualitative detection system enables early detection of chlamydia during routine testing, enabling diagnosis of chlamydia infection in the early stages of infection, even with plasmid-free variants of C trachomatis. This is a significant step forward in chlamydia detection, said Dr. Ulrich Spengler, managing director of Qiagen Hamburg GmbH, because serious consequences, such as sterility and blindness, can be prevented by early treatment. In contrast to traditional methods, the Artus C trachomatis plus PCR kit is the only system worldwide that detects both the chlamydial cryptic plasmid and the ompA gene in parallel.

Artus C trachomatis plus PCR kits are ready-to-use reagent systems for detection of C trachomatis DNA by real-time PCR. An internal control, supplied with the kits, serves as a control for DNA purification and to detect false negatives due to possible PCR inhibition. Excellent sensitivity and specificity have been demonstrated during validation of the kits using swab, urine, and sperm samples.
